There are three types of navigations in Teletype GPS Pro. They are Marine, Air, and Street. The following is a brief description of each.

Marine Navigation

Provides the most comprehensive set of navigation information for water travel. Each of the parameters shown in this panel are described in the Parameter List.

The Maine Navigation will allow you to see Marine Raster or Marine Vector maps. For Marine Vectors maps, you will be able to view detail information about locations of known ship wrecks, buoys, rocks underneath the ocean, ferry routes, and dockable areas. For more information on how to use this feature, go to your Marine Vector Manual (Note: Add-On must be purchased separately for both Marine Raster and Vectors Maps).


Aviation Navigation

For use by pilots when flying. In order to use aviation, you must have purchase the aviation maps from Teletype GPS.


Street Navigation

Street Navigation is used when navigating a generated route. The street navigation has voice to tell you where to turn and displays
to the user what points of interest are nearby.



To change the navigation, you can go to Tools -> Navigation. Then check the type of navigation that you want.
